what is the law of superposition ? what is it used for?

Respuesta :

Myaww
Myaww Myaww
  • 01-02-2018
The law of superposition is a statement that says rocks on the bottom are always older than the top and the top is always younger than the one on the bottom... It is used to tell which rock layer or fossils are older/younger..
